REALLY THAT GOOD is a new kind of film-criticism series, built around the radical premise that just because "everyone knows" a movie is a classic doesn't mean it stops being worth a deeper look.

That THE AVENGERS changed the landscape of action cinema in general and superhero movies in particular isn't in dispute, and in the wake of huge returns for its sequel AGE OF ULTRON and the ongoing success of the Marvel Cinematic Universe it's stature as a modern pop-culture classic is well-assured. But is that all there is to it?

With curmudgeonly critics already weighing in about "superhero fatigue" and the mixed success of other studios attempting the "cinematic universe" gambit, many are beginning to ask if the potency of Joss Whedon's blockbuster team-up has been overstated - or even overrated? Have fanboys, fangirls, comic-book devotees and continuity-mongers gone too far in proclaiming its greatness, or is THE AVENGERS... Really That Good?
